Decoding Your Honda Outboard Wiring Diagram
A Honda Outboard Wiring Diagram is essentially a blueprint for your outboard's electrical system. It illustrates how various components are connected, including the battery, starter motor, alternator, ignition system, fuel injection system, trim and tilt, and essential sensors. Each wire is typically color-coded and labeled, allowing you to trace the flow of electricity and identify potential issues. Having a clear understanding of this diagram is incredibly important for performing any electrical work on your Honda outboard.
These diagrams are indispensable for several reasons. Mechanics and DIY enthusiasts use them to:
- Diagnose electrical problems such as a dead battery, a non-starting engine, or malfunctioning gauges.
- Identify the correct wires for specific functions, like connecting a new tachometer or installing additional accessories.
- Perform routine maintenance, ensuring all connections are secure and functioning as intended.
- Understand the role of each electrical component and how it contributes to the overall operation of the outboard.
When you encounter an electrical issue, the Honda Outboard Wiring Diagram becomes your primary reference. You'll often see symbols representing different components and lines indicating the wires connecting them. For example, a diagram might show:
- The battery terminals connecting to the main power switch.
- The ignition switch receiving power and sending it to the ignition coil.
- The starter solenoid activating the starter motor when the ignition is turned.
